The European Union has mandated that high environmental standards be met in the design and manufacture of electronic and electrical products sold in Europe, to reduce hazardous substances from entering the environment. The “Restriction on Hazardous Substances Directive (RoHS)” prescribes the maximum trace levels of lead, cad- mium, mercury, hexavalent chromium, and flame retardants PBB and PBDE that may be contained in a product. Only products meeting these high environmental standards may be “placed on the market” in EU member states after July 1, 2006. Supply Of Fresh Air The 8580/8590 is based on a passive cooling concept. As a result, the waste heat which is produced inside the device is emitted over the surface of the housing. For this system to function properly, sufficient fresh air circulation is required. Never install the system in a closed environment where the cooling air is unable to dissipate accumulated heat to the outside. If the 8580/8590 is not able to draw in fresh cooling air, this may cause overheating and severe damage to the unit. The maximum allowed ambient temperature for the system needs to be taken into account for the concrete application area. The vehicle-mount is powered up by connecting it to an appropriate power supply and then, depending on the version of the device, either using the power switch or the ignition signal Important: Make sure there is a suitable disconnecting device such as a power switch or circuit breaker in the power supply circuit. 2.14 Protecting The TFT Display From Memory Effect The TFT display of the 8580/8590 has to be protected from the burning in of a motionless image. An image that has remained motionless for too long can cause irreversible damage to the display. With TFT displays there no cathode rays burning in an afterimage as in old TV sets or monitors, but TFT displays still have a “memory effect”. This is because with a still image the liquid crystal molecules align themselves in a certain way and become inert if they are not moved. Like burning in the effect is irreversible, but can be avoided by regularly turning off the display or by using a screen saver with changing content. Define in the power management center of the utilized operating system that the displays of the 8580/8590 should be turned off when no user input occurs. A motionless image can stay on the display for a maximum of 12 hours. After more than 12 hours there is the risk of the “memory effect”. 28 8580/8590 Vehicle-Mount Computer User Manual Chapter 2: Basic Checkout Protecting The TFT Display From Memory Effect Important: The following is important for the lifespan of the backlighting: Choose a turn off time that is definitely not too short (not less than 30 min) since frequent turning on of the backlighting will noticeably reduce its lifespan. This particularly applies at low temperatures. Here the backlighting of the display should never be switched off but instead a screen saver should be used which displays a changing or completely black screen in order to achieve the maximum lifespan of the backlighting. 8580/8590 Vehicle-Mount Computer User Manual 29 3 ACCESSORIES 3.1 Keyboards . . . . . . . . . . . 3.1.1 The SMALL Keyboard . 3.1.2 The 24-Key Keypad . . 3.2 Mouse . . . . . . . . . . . . . 3.3 External CD-ROM Drive . . . 3.3.1 Operation . . . . . . . . 3.3.2 Resources And Drivers . 3.4 USB Stick . . . . . . . . . . . 3.5 Scanner .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. 33 33 34 34 35 35 35 35 36 8580/8590 Vehicle-Mount Computer User Manual 31 Chapter 3: Accessories Keyboards 3.1 Keyboards On the 8580/8590, any keyboard with a 6-pin Mini-DIN plug can be connected (PS/2). Make sure that the connecting cables are laid without kinks and are protected. 4.4 Vehicle Applications (Such As Forklifts) Pay special attention to the various electrical potentials when installing the unit on a vehicle (such as a forklift). In the 8580/8590, the logic ground and the shield ground are firmly linked. The “logic ground” is the earth line (GND) for all of the internal electrical components, such as the hard drive and the CPU. 8580/8590 Vehicle-Mount Computer User Manual 45 Chapter 4: 8580/8590 Installation Vehicle Applications (Such As Forklifts) Warning: Carefully read the following warnings! • Never connect a 12 VDC device to a 24/48 VDC vehicle! The device model is identified on the device type plate, a warning sticker is affixed to the unit and on the external connector strip. • Some forklifts have a chassis that is connected to DC. Therefore, the 8580/8590 chassis is also connected to DC. However, if you use peripheral devices that supply DC- to the 8580/8590 via an interconnector (such as a DC- serial port), this will cause a short circuit. This will inevitably lead to malfunctions or even a total system failure. • In DC-powered devices, always attach ring tongues on the supply voltage cable to the ground bolt situated on the connector bay. Position of ground bolt • Make sure that the 8580/8590 connecting cable is attached as close to the battery as possible. Connecting the vehicle-mount to large electrical loads, such as converters for the forklift motor may result in random restarts, malfunctions and/or irreparable damage to the device. • If you want to connect devices fed by other power sources to the 8580/8590, such as certain PS/2-Wedges, printers and so on, be sure to power up the peripheral devices at the same time or after the vehicle-mount. Otherwise, you may encounter start-up problems, malfunctions or even irreparable damage to the device. 46 8580/8590 Vehicle-Mount Computer User Manual Chapter 4: 8580/8590 Installation Wiring Vehicle Power To The 8580/8590 4.4.1 Wiring Vehicle Power To The 8580/8590 Warning: Applying a voltage above the input voltage rating or reversing polarity may result in permanent damage to the 8580/8590 and will void the product warranty. A 1.8 meter (6 ft.) extension power cable (PN 13985–301) is supplied with your. This cable should be wired to a filtered, fused (maximum 10A) accessory supply on the vehicle. Any additional wiring (minimum 18 gauge), connectors or disconnects used should be rated for at least 90 VDC, 10A. When connecting PN 13985-301, ensure that the screen blanking wires (clearly labelled) and the power wires (red/black leads) are reliably secured away from each other, or are separated with reliably secured certified insulation. Minimum 2.8mm distance, or 0.4mm distance through insulation is required for the separation. The red lead of the power cable attaches to the positive vehicle supply. The black lead connects to the negative supply – this should be connected to a proper terminal block and not to the vehicle body. The 8580/90 is fully isolated and can be used with both negative and positive chassis vehicles. You may have the option of connecting power before or after the ‘key’ switch. It is preferable to wire the 8580/8590 after the key switch – that is, the 8580/8590 cannot be switched on without turning the vehicle key on. However, if the operator switches the key off repeatedly for long periods during a shift, it may make more sense to wire the 8580/90 before the switch. Keep in mind that the 8580/8590 will continue to operate with or without vehicle power as long as its backup battery has sufficient charge. If an unfused power source must be used, a fuse assembly (PN 19440) must be added to the extension power cable (the fuse and instructions are supplied with the cable). Use only a 10A slow blow UL approved fuse in the fuse assembly. The fuse assembly must be located as close as practical to the DC supply, and shall connect to the positive side of the DC supply. 8580/8590 Vehicle-Mount Computer User Manual 47 Chapter 4: 8580/8590 Installation Cable Cover (Splash Guard) 4.5 Cable Cover (Splash Guard) Important: For safety reasons, the supplied cable cover for the external ports must be installed prior to using the 8580/8590. This applies, for example, to the successive switching through of the keyboards with VK_KB_SWITCHNEXT. 8580/8590 Vehicle-Mount Computer User Manual 101 7 SERIAL PORTS 7.1 Serial Ports . . . . . . . . . . . . . 7.1.1 Resources . . . . . . . . . . . 7.1.2 COM1 Options . . . . . . . . 7.1.3 COM1 As A Power Supply . . 7.1.4 Serial Port Printers . . . . . . 7.1.5 Serial Port Bar Code Scanners 7.1.6 Tips & Tricks .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. .105 .105 .105 .105 .105 .105 .106 8580/8590 Vehicle-Mount Computer User Manual 103 Chapter 7: Serial Ports Serial Ports 7.1 Serial Ports By default the 8580/8590 is equipped with 4 serial ports. COM1 and COM2 are accessible from the outside. COM3 and COM4 are used internally for communication with the environment controller and the touch controller. 7.1.1 Resources Resources for the serial ports are pre-defined in the system architecture and automatically managed by the BIOS. The resources for COM1, COM2, COM3 and COM4 can be defined via the BIOS. The standard resources for serial ports are: COM1 Address 0x3F8 - 0x3FF (hexadecimal), Interrupt IRQ4 COM2 Address 0x2F8 - 0x2FF (hexadecimal), Interrupt IRQ3 COM3 Address 0x3E8 - 0x3EF (hexadecimal), Interrupt IRQ10 COM4 Address 0x2E8 - 0x2EF (hexadecimal), Interrupt IRQ11 7.1.2 COM1 Options The following section describes what needs to be observed when using the COM1 port to supply power to external equipment. The resources required for the COM1 controller module are automatically reserved by the BIOS. 7.1.3 COM1 As A Power Supply The COM1 port can optionally supply externally connected equipment with +12 V or +5 V of power. The voltages are protected by internal fuses which limit the total consumed current to 1.1 A at 5 V (including keyboard and mouse). The current consumption at 12 V is also limited to 1.1 A by a reversible fuse. Depending on the specific system configuration, the maximum current consumption at +12 V may be significantly lower. 7.1.4 Serial Port Printers Printers with a serial port can be connected to the 8580/8590. 7.1.5 Serial Port Bar Code Scanners To activate the integrated scanner software wedge under Windows XP Embedded: 8580/8590 Vehicle-Mount Computer User Manual 105 Chapter 7: Serial Ports Tips & Tricks 1. Otherwise the software wedge will not function properly. 7.1.6 Tips & Tricks Note that according to the EIA-232-E specification, the maximum cable length is 15 m at 19,200 bps. Malfunctions in the RS-232 connections are frequently caused by ground loops. If both end devices establish a ground connection via RS-232 but do not share the same ground potential in their power supply circuits, then compensation currents may result. This is particularly noticeable with long cables. These compensation currents, which are also present at the ground point of the RS-232 connection, may significantly degrade signal quality and effectively stop the data flow. In challenging environments, electrically-isolated connections (via external converters) are strongly recommended. 106 8580/8590 Vehicle-Mount Computer User Manual 8 INTERNAL DEVICES 8.1 Chipset .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. 8.1.1 Installing Chipset Drivers Under Windows XP . . . . . . 8.2 VGA Adaptor . . . . . . . . . . . . . . . . . . . . . . . . . . . 8.2.1 VGA Driver Installation Under Windows XP . . . . . . . 8.3 Network Adaptor (10/100) . . . . . . . . . . . . . . . . . . . . 8.3.1 Network Driver Installation Under Windows XP . . . . . 8.4 Onboard Sound Adaptor . . . . . . . . . . . . . . . . . . . . . 8.4.1 Installing Onboard Sound Adaptor Drivers–Windows XP . 8.5 Touchscreen . . . . . . . . . . . . . . . . . . . . . . . . . . . . 8.5.1 Touch (Serial) For Windows XP & XP Embedded. . . . . 8.5.1.1 Installation . . . . . . . . . . . . . . . . . . . . . 8.5.1.2 Calibration . . . . . . . . . . . . . . . . . . . . . 8.5.2 Touch (PS2) For Windows XP & XP Embedded. . . . . . 8.5.2.1 Installation . . . . . . . . . . . . . . . . . . . . . 8.5.2.2 Calibration . . . . . . . . . . . . . . . . . . . . . 8.5.3 Resistance Of The Touchscreen . . . . . . . . . . . . . . 8.6 Automatic Switch-Off And Heating . . . . . . . . . . . . . . . 8.6.1 Automatic Shutdown Process. . . . . . . . . . . . . . . . 8.6.1.1 Program Flowchart . . . . . . . . . . . . . . . . 8.6.2 Drivers . . . . . . . . . . . . . . . . . . . . . . . . . . . 8.6.3 General Notes About Automatic Shutdown Software .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. .109 .109 .110 .110 . 111 .112 .113 .113 .115 .115 .115 .116 .117 .117 .117 .118 .119 .120 .121 .123 .123 8580/8590 Vehicle-Mount Computer User Manual 107 Chapter 8: Internal Devices Chipset 8.1 Chipset The 8580/8590 computer is equipped with a chipset which controls the communication between all function modules. Explanation Of Functions A touchscreen controller for resistive touchscreens is integrated into the motherboard to analyze the sensor line state changes caused by touching. The touchscreen controller calculates and formats this data and then sends it to the touchscreen software driver via the COM4 port or optionally the mouse-PS/2 port (interrupt-controlled). The driver converts the data into pointer commands. The analog touchscreen controller used for analysis provides a resolution of 4096 x 4096 pixels (12-bit horizontal and vertical). 4-wire touchscreens (10.4" front panel) and also 8-wire touchscreens (12.1" front panel) are supported. Resources By default the resources for the touchscreen controller are the same as for the COM4 port. If the appropriate configuration exists, these may also be the same as for the PS/2 mouse. With the exception of ensuring that the jumpers are set correctly J6 (open = Touch active) and J13 (closed=PS/2, open=COM4), no further configuration is required. 8.5.1 Touch (Serial) For Windows XP & XP Embedded 8.5.1.1 Installation The touch drivers to be used can, by default, be found on the Compact Flash or hard drive under Util/atouch/ . Modes Of Operation If wired up accordingly, the 8580/8590 conveniently switches off together with the vehicle's ignition. As disconnecting the power supply during operation can lead to data loss, the operating system needs to be shut down normally using the appropriate hardware and software installed on the system when the ignition is switched off. The 8580/8590 is connected to the vehicle with three supply cables. DC+ and DCare directly connected to the power supply of the vehicle, the connection is of course run through fuses (refer to “DC Power Pack” on page 44). Therefore make sure that the cables are connected directly to the battery and not to high-interference supply lines (for example, motor supply) or to supply lines already used by other consumers. The supply voltage connected is then linked to the 8580/8590 ignition input via a switch, for example, the key switch of the ignition (also with a fuse, see “Power Supply Fuses” on page 115). 8580/8590 Vehicle-Mount Computer User Manual 119 Chapter 8: Internal Devices Automatic Shutdown Process Heating is required if you want to operate the 8580/8590 at ambient temperatures below 0 C. In the following two sections, the main functions of the automatic heating and shutdown modules are described. For detailed information on the automatic shutdown and heating modules - complete with pre-defined thresholds - refer to the program flowchart diagrams (part 1 and 2) below. Resources The automatic switch-off/heating module requires the COM3 port for configuration. In normal use the LPT1 port is used for communication. 8.6.1 Automatic Shutdown Process When the ignition is switched on, the 8580/8590 is supplied with power and begins checking its internal temperature and automatic shutdown function. Once the ambient conditions have been verified as acceptable, the 8580/8590 starts the operating system just like normal. During the first three minutes of the start-up phase, none of the ambient conditions, such as the internal temperature or the Ignition input status, are checked. This allows the operating system and the operating software for the automatic shutdown module to fully load without interruption. Following this three-minute period, the internal temperature of the unit and the status of the Ignition input are checked continuously. If the inner temperature of the 8580/8590 reaches a critical range, the operating system is shut down normally and the computer remains switched off until the temperature is back in the permitted range. If the Ignition input is switched to earth potential or a potential-free source during normal operation, the unit switches to shutdown delay time. In this state, the device continues to operate normally until the delay time (for example, 15 minutes) has elapsed. • If the ignition is triggered again during this time, the 8580/8590 resumes normal operation. • If, however, the delay time elapses, the operating system is shut down normally by the 8580/8590 operating software and the unit is automatically switched off (for example, after three minutes, or after a signal from the operating software). 120 8580/8590 Vehicle-Mount Computer User Manual Chapter 8: Internal Devices Program Flowchart 8.6.1.1 Program Flowchart Figure 8.1 Automatic Shutdown Program Flowchart – Part 1 8580/8590 Vehicle-Mount Computer User Manual 121 Chapter 8: Internal Devices Program Flowchart Figure 8.2 Automatic Shutdown Program Flowchart – Part 2 122 8580/8590 Vehicle-Mount Computer User Manual Chapter 8: Internal Devices Drivers 8.6.2 Drivers DLoGPwrw.sys driver V1.0 for Windows XP Standard setting: I/O port 0x379, length 2 Bytes The 8580/8590 and the automatic shutdown module communicate via the motherboard control port, which consists of the two I/O ports described above. 8.6.3 General Notes About Automatic Shutdown Software The Config program must be installed for the automatic shutdown module to function correctly. If the Config has not been started, the 8580/8590 will carry out a hard shutdown once the delay time and shutdown time set by the hardware has elapsed. In this case, the operating system is not shut down normally before the power is switched off. The current application is unable to save its data, and the file system becomes increasingly unstable and inconsistent. If the Config has been started, the program can recognize when the operating system needs to be shut down. Firstly, the Windows message “WM_QUERYENDSESSION” is sent to all running applications to inform them of the impending shutdown. Now every application has to respond within the time that is set in the registry. If a response is not sent in the specified time, the application is forced to quit. If there are any open programs with unsaved changes, it may not be possible to automatically quit them (for example, an unsaved document in WORDPAD.EXE, a program supplied with Windows). In this case WORDPAD.EXE responds to the Windows message “WM_QUERYENDSESSION” with a user query to confirm if the current file is to be saved. Applications that can be quit with the key combination [ALT] and [F4] (that is, without a final user query) generally send the required response to the “WM_QUERYENDSESSION” message and are not shutdown “hard”. To ensure that vital data is always saved correctly, applications need to be able to properly respond to the “WM_QUERYENDSESSION” message, that is, without user queries and within the set time period. 8580/8590 Vehicle-Mount Computer User Manual 123 MAINTENANCE 9 9.1 Maintenance. .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. .127 9.1.1 Cleaning The Housing . . . . . . . . . . . . . . . . . . . . . . . .127 9.1.2 Cleaning The Touchscreen . . . . . . . . . . . . . . . . . . . . . .127 8580/8590 Vehicle-Mount Computer User Manual 125 Chapter 9: Maintenance Maintenance 9.1 Maintenance Follow the guidelines below when cleaning your 8580/8590. 9.1.1 Cleaning The Housing • • • Use a damp cloth to clean the housing of the 8580/8590. Pin Signal Name 1 TxP Transmit + 2 TxN Transmit - 3 RxP Receive + 4 CTTD Transmit Centre Termination 5 CTRD Receive Centre Termination 6 RxN Receive - 7 n.c. 8 TERM Termination 8580/8590 Vehicle-Mount Computer User Manual C-3 APPENDIX D MECHANICAL DYNAMIC LOADING D.1 Introduction The mechanical environmental conditions of the 8580/8590 can vary greatly in terms of vibrations, collisions and shocks. The matter is made more difficult by the fact that the random values for acceleration and their frequencies for a given location are often unknown. It is therefore useful to divide the values into three operation classes 5M3, 5M2 and 5M1 on the basis of standards, previous measurements and experience. The following standards offer a practical means of reference: • DIN EN 60721-3-5: 1998 classification of environmental conditions, part 3, section 5: Use on and in ground vehicles. • Military standard MIL-STD 810F: 2000. (5)M3 Mobile Use Operational environments with high energy vibrations and high energy shocks as well as rough handling/transport compliant with: • Operation class 5M3 according to DIN EN 60721-3-5 or equivalent. • Category US Highway Truck according to MIL-STD 810F. • Examples: Vehicles without shock absorption: Fork lifts, unbalanced machines: Combustion engine of a construction machine. (5)M2 Restricted Mobile Application Operational environments with low energy vibrations and high energy shocks as well as careful handling/transport compliant with: • Operation class 5M2 according to DIN EN 60721-3-5 or equivalent. • Category US Highway Truck according to MIL-STD 810F. • Examples: Vehicles with shock absorption: Driver's cab in a tractor, standing machines: Machine tools. 8580/8590 Vehicle-Mount Computer User Manual D-1 Appendix D: Mechanical Dynamic Loading Units Without Vibration Insulation (tuned to high frequency) (5)M1 Stationary Use Operational environments with low energy vibrations and medium energy shocks as well as very careful handling/transport compliant with: • Operation class 5M1 according to DIN EN 60721-3-5. • Examples: Vehicles with very good shock absorption: Car dashboard, immobile mounting surfaces: Desk or wall. D.2 Units Without Vibration Insulation (tuned to high frequency) Selection criteria: Stationary, partly mobile or fully mobile applications for which components offering insulation against vibrations cannot be used or are not required. Important: The 8580/8590 system can vibrate and should therefore be installed using the bracket as rigidly as possible. With their variable mountings, the 8580/8590 units form a spring-mass system that can result in excitation by one or more random vibrations or shocks from its surroundings. This system reacts with natural oscillations, the amplitudes of which can be up to 20 times greater than the excitation amplitudes (resonance effects). The goal is therefore to remove resonance points of this kind or at least to tune the system to such a high frequency that they fall within the range of low excitation amplitudes. For an initial assessment, you can test the device by hand. Bring the system to excitation by gently hitting it with your hand. If the 8580/8590 starts to visibly oscillate and if the vibrations take a long time to die away, it is probable that the natural frequency is too low. In this case, we recommend reinforcing the fixing points to the maximum bending moments (through the use of rigid sections, for example). Practically speaking, natural frequencies above 100 Hz are sufficient. However, those below 50 Hz are likely to lead to damaging amplitudes during resonance which may result in fatigue fractures along the outer mounting parts or on the internal electronic components or even a loosening of the connections. D-2 8580/8590 Vehicle-Mount Computer User Manual Appendix D: Mechanical Dynamic Loading Passive Vibration Insulation (tuned to low frequency) D.3 Passive Vibration Insulation (tuned to low frequency) Selection criteria: Mobile use Note: The system can be tuned to a low frequency by installing a flexible bearing. For example, you can attach the mounting bracket to elastomer springs or rubber buffers. The ideal total spring constant should be dimensioned in such a way so that the natural frequency of the system falls below the lowest excitation frequency. All excitations with a frequency greater than 1.4 times the natural frequency would then be dampened by a counter-phase effect. This is practically impossible, if you consider that excitation accelerations within the range of around 10 Hz to 200 Hz or more may occur. Furthermore, the springs of the 8580/8590 would strongly deflect while static or visibly swivel while resonating (blurred display). Based on our experience, we have found that the natural frequencies of unsprung ground vehicles lie between 15 Hz and 25 Hz. Although the elastic bearing does create an interfering resonance, it can suppress high excitation frequencies to various degrees of success. D.4 Dimensioning Example 8580 Example for dimensioning an elastic bearing with mounting bracket for mobile application. The 8580 is screwed into a mobile position with a mounting bracket. Elastomer springs should be installed between the back of the mounting bracket and the assembly surface in the vehicle so that the depth can be adjusted. The point of resonance for the spatial axis with the greatest deflection should be 20Hz. • Which elastomer springs are suitable? • Which insulating effects can be expected for different excitation frequencies? 8580/8590 Vehicle-Mount Computer User Manual D-3 Appendix D: Mechanical Dynamic Loading Dimensioning Example 8580 Mounting example for table-top attachment with elastomer springs: • 8580 with mobile mounting bracket, adjustable to 15 degrees • 3 elastomer springs • Diameter 30 to 40 mm, 20 to 30 mm high • Natural rubber • Total vibrating weight of 8580: approx. 5 kg D-4 8580/8590 Vehicle-Mount Computer User Manual Appendix D: Mechanical Dynamic Loading Approximate Solution For Elastomer Spring Selection D.4.1 Approximate Solution For Elastomer Spring Selection Since ω² = c / m, we obtain the following relationship: c≅ 4π ² 2 2 ⋅ m ⋅ fe ≈ 0,039 ⋅ m ⋅ fe = 78 N / mm 1000 Where: m fe c = oscillatory mass = natural frequency = spring constant in N/mm = 5 kg = 20 Hz This model applies to the oscillatory mass at the device's center of gravity. This lies around 120 mm above the mounting surface of the group of springs and also displaced from it. To determine the spring constant for an individual elastomer spring, the leverages and arrangement of the springs (here in a triangle) must also be considered. Furthermore, each of the 4 elastomer springs connected in parallel must deliver one third of the total spring constant, i.e., 78 N/mm / 3 = 26 N/mm. To simplify matters, of the 6 possible degrees of freedom we will only consider those with the greatest deflection in the case of the 8580. In other words: We observe the display as it oscillates towards or away from us (a combination of rotational and longitudinal oscillation). Comparative measurements for precisely the arrangement displayed in Table-top attachment with elastomer springs diagram on the previous page: Attachment (construction of the mounting bracket, quantity and position of the elastomer springs) show that the individual spring must be stiffer by a factor of 25 for the mathematical model stated above to be applied. Important: Factors for other mountings with elastomer springs must be calculated through testing! As a result, this model gives a value of 26 N/mm x 22.5 = 585 N/mm for the required single spring constant. 8580/8590 Vehicle-Mount Computer User Manual D-5 Appendix D: Mechanical Dynamic Loading Further Possible Steps For Optimization The next step is to look through the manufacturer's datasheets (such as those from gmt-gmbh.de or simrit.de) to find the right types of elastomer springs and rubber buffers. Here we have decided to use springs with an M8 thread and cylindrical body made of natural rubber (NR). Based on the datasheet for a diameter of 30 mm and a height of 20 mm, for example, we arrived at the pressure load: Compressive force 539 N / Displacement 1 mm = 539 N/mm for a Shore hardness A 70. This value lies below the default value. What is the natural frequency? The following formula can be used to calculate the natural frequency: fe ≈ 5,03 ⋅ c = 19.1Hz m Where: fe = natural frequency in Hz c = total spring constant m = oscillatory mass = 539 N/mm (calculated from datasheet values) * 3 (springs) / 22.5 (factor) = 71.9 N/mm = 5 kg This theoretical value of 19.1 Hz lies in the range of 20 Hz to 5 Hz as measured in practice. The calculations depicted above are only approximations, which is why we recommend a final field test with the selected elastomer springs. D.4.2 Further Possible Steps For Optimization • D-6 If it turns out that the 8580/8590 resonance deflections could be greater, the natural frequency can be reduced. 8580/8590 Vehicle-Mount Computer User Manual Appendix D: Mechanical Dynamic Loading Determining Insulating Effects In our selected example, softer elastomer springs with the same construction could be used. In that case, it would still be possible that a Shore hardness of A55 activates approx. 13 Hz. • However, if the resonance deflections are too high (10 mm and more), the natural frequency should be increased. For example, using 3 elastomer springs with a diameter of 40 instead of 30 mm or using 4 instead of 3 springs. The number, form, material type and arrangement of the elastomer springs can be used to control the natural frequency. As a rule, constructions with vulcanized fittings are used. Important: Static tensile loads on the elastomer springs should be avoided, as the elastomer can tear easily. A 8580/8590 should therefore never be suspended from elastomer springs. D.4.3 Determining Insulating Effects A transmission function can be used to reach an exact calculation. However, we will not detail this function here. The following equation is based on this transmission function (very small damping factors of approx. 0.05) and is good for making estimates: 8580/8590 Vehicle-Mount Computer User Manual D-7 Appendix D: Mechanical Dynamic Loading Determining Insulating Effects Excitation Frequency Natural Frequency Degree Of Insulation 10Hz 20Hz 0.5 -33% Warning! Amplification 20Hz 20Hz 1 Warning!Resonance, approx. – 500% and greater! High amplification! Approx. 28Hz 20Hz 2 0, no insulation 40Hz 20Hz 2 66% 60Hz 20Hz 3 88% 80Hz 20Hz 4 93% Based on this table, we can clearly expect very good insulation for excitation frequencies that are twice as high as the system's natural frequency. Consequently, the amplitude of the reaction accelerations of the 8580/8590 still only reaches 66% of the amplitude of the excitation accelerations, which actually have an effect twice that of the natural frequency. The table also demonstrates the costs of achieving this, namely that all excitation frequencies below the natural frequency are amplified - to a maximum when resonance occurs. Implication For Designing Computer Mounts: • If high energy excitation frequencies mainly occur in the region of the natural frequency of the 8580/8590 with its mounting, which can be found, for example, in a vehicle chassis tuned to a low frequency. In this case a spring mounting of the 8580/8590 should be avoided. • However, if high energy excitation frequencies mainly occur above the natural frequency, it is recommended that you use passive vibration insulation for the computer. This applies to unsprung fork lifts with solid rubber tires or for unbalanced machines with relatively constant and correspondingly high operating speed. Random samples of fork lift rotors were taken and the field excitations measured: D-8 8580/8590 Vehicle-Mount Computer User Manual Appendix D: Mechanical Dynamic Loading Determining Natural Frequencies Track: Warehouses with loading thresholds, potholes and pallet splinters. Amplitude of the excitation accelerations: Mean value ±1g to ±2g for all three spatial axes with peak values ±5g approximately twice each minute and ±8g to ±13g occasionally. Excitation frequencies: 5Hz to 200Hz These values can be assigned to operation class 5M3. Important: The basic 8580/8590 is designed for operation class 5M3. Depending on the equipment (e.g. 24-key keyboard) and mounting types (e.g. with elastomer springs), the operation class can be reduced to 5M2 or 5M1. If you have any questions regarding the permissible operation class, please contact the Psion Teklogix technical service department. D.5 Determining Natural Frequencies There are several ways of determining a system's natural frequencies: • Take field measurements with acceleration sensors and frequency analyses (very time-consuming, but produces accurate results for all spatial axes) • Calculating the known static spring deflection using the following quantity equation (minimal measurement work, very good approximation) fe ≈ 15,8 xSt Where: fe xst Note: = natural frequency in Hz = static spring deflection in mm = deflection of the center of gravity in the direction of the gravitational force (for example using a mechanical timer) Further technical information can be found in the product documents provided by the elastomer spring manufacturers. 8580/8590 Vehicle-Mount Computer User Manual D-9 APPENDIX E BIOS E.1 BIOS Setup Description The following section describes the BIOS setup program. E.11 BIOS Security Features The BIOS provides both a supervisor and user password. If you use both passwords, the supervisor password must be set first. The system can be configured so that all users must enter a password every time the system boots or when setup is executed. The two passwords activate two different levels of security. If you select password support you are prompted for a one to six character password. Type the password on the keyboard. The password does not appear on the screen when typed. The supervisor password (supervisor mode) gives unrestricted access to view and change all the setup options. The user password (user mode) gives restricted access to view and change setup options. If only the supervisor password is set, pressing [ENTER] at the password prompt of the BIOS setup program allows the user restricted access to setup. Setting the password check to ‘Always’ restricts who can boot the system. The password prompt will be displayed before the system attempts to load the operating system. If only the supervisor password is set, pressing [ENTER] at the password prompt allows the user to boot the system. E.12 Hard Disk Security Features Hard disk security uses the security mode feature commands defined in the ATA specification. This functionality allows users to protect data using drive-level passwords. The passwords are kept within the drive, so data is protected even if the drive is moved to another computer system. E-26 8580/8590 Vehicle-Mount Computer User Manual Appendix E: BIOS Hard Disk Security Features The BIOS provides the ability to ‘lock’ and ‘unlock’ drives using the security password. A ‘locked’ drive will be detected by the system, but no data can be accessed. Accessing data on a ‘locked’ drive requires the proper password to ‘unlock’ the disk. The BIOS enables users to enable/disable hard disk security for each hard drive in setup. A master password is available if the user can not remember the user password. Both passwords can be set independently however the drive will only lock if a user password is installed. The max length of the passwords is 32 bytes. During POST each hard drive is checked for security mode feature support. In case the drive supports the feature and it is locked, the BIOS prompts the user for the user password. If the user does not enter the correct user password within five attempts, the user is notified that the drive is locked and POST continues as normal. If the user enters the correct password, the drive is unlocked until the next reboot. In order to ensure that the ATA security features are not compromised by viruses or malicious programs when the drive is typically unlocked, the BIOS disables the ATA security features at the end of POST to prevent their misuse. Without this protection it would be possible for viruses or malicious programs to set a password on a drive thereby blocking the user from accessing the data. 8580/8590 Vehicle-Mount Computer User
